CVE-2022-22963 and CVE-2022-22965 - "Spring4Shell" Vulnerability Response
CVE-2022-22963 Description In Spring Cloud Function versions 3.1.6, 3.2.2 and older unsupported versions, when using routing functionality it is possible for a user to provide a specially crafted SpEL as a routing-expression that may result in remote code execution and access to local resources. CVE-2021-34527 - Windows Print Spooler Remote Code Execution Vulnerability
Microsoft recently released a CVE regarding the Windows Print Spooler service. Since neither GoAnywhere MFT nor GoAnywhere Gateway interact with windows Print Spooler, neither application should be susceptible to this vulnerability. Quick Start for AS4
Quick Start for AS4 Service Applicability Statement 4 (AS4) is a message protocol based on SOAP and Web Services to securely exchange messages between business partners.
